In Telangana, incessant rains continue to batter especially northern districts of the state. Hundreds of villages have been inundated due to swollen rivers and streams. Thousands of people who reside close to the banks of water bodies have been shifted to relief camps.<br />''<br />''River Godavari is on spate and flowing at 60.3 ft at Bhadrachalam. The local authorities have imposed 144 sections asking people not to venture out as the river is in fury and many low-lying areas have been inundated. The authorities are predicting a further rise in the water levels of the River Godavari.<br />''<br />''AIR Correspondent reports that heavy rains pounding over the northern districts of Telangana left many villages and towns inundated. Rivers and several streams are on spate posing threat to normal life. Dozens of villages have been cut off from the rest of the places following road connectivity got washed away. NDRF team has been stationed at Bhadrachalam and local authorities have imposed section 144 to prevent people to go to riversides.<br />''<br />''<span style="color: #222222;">The authorities also appealed to people from other parts not to visit the temple town for next few days. On the other hand, the state authorities are taking all measures to prevent loss of life due to flood fury and heavy rains</span><br />
